Requirements for UoN Jobs

Applicants are generally expected to have:

  • Relevant academic qualifications from recognized institutions
  • Professional certifications are applicable
  • Experience in a similar role
  • Strong communication and teamwork skills
  • Compliance with Chapter Six of the Constitution

How to Apply

Interested candidates should apply through the official University of Nairobi recruitment portal or follow the instructions provided in each advertisement. Applications typically require a CV, cover letter, academic certificates, and supporting documents.

Important Notes

  • The University of Nairobi does not charge any recruitment fees
  • Only shortlisted candidates are contacted
  • Applicants are encouraged to apply early before the deadlines
